Pressure Washing
A pressure washer is probably the most important thing you need to clean concrete. You should start off by trying to just clean the surface with some mild soap and strong water pressure. This usually does enough to remove green and brown stains from dirt and leaves. But, you might need to use more heavy duty cleaner to break down black stains from oil or tire markings. Trisodium phosphate (or TSP) can be very useful for heavy stains. You basically spray it on to the damaged area, get it moist, and let it soak in for a bit to break down the dirt. Then, you use the pressure washer to spray it out and get the dirt out of the pores.
In addition to the pressure washer, it might be necessary to use a scrub brush for the stubborn stains. This can loosen the dirt, which makes it much easier to wash away. You might have to scrub very vigorously, but it will be well worth it in the end when you have a clean and uniform concrete finish. If you can't satisfactorily clean your concrete surface, you can consider adding a glazed finish to it. A colored glaze finish can restore the concrete and largely cover the blemishes and staining. It is a great solution if you want to change the way that you concrete looks, while also protecting it from future staining.
